Sandy Creek, NY -- State police are continuing to investigate Wednesday's all-terrain vehicle crash that injured an 11-year-old girl in Oswego County.
The girl was conscious but said little to police about what occurred to cause the accident, Trooper Charlotte Yerdon said this morning. Yerdon said she would not release the name of the girl until she had spoken this morning with her parents.
Emergency responders were called to 17 Nellis Drive in Sandy Creek shortly before 5 p.m.on a report that an ATV had flipped, Oswego County emergency dispatchers said.
The rider was taken by Air One to Upstate University Hospital.
